Gene summary:

Species Saccharomyces cerevisiae (Sce)
Primary name SNO2
SGD link S000005278
Alternative ID YNL334C
Description Protein of unknown function, nearly identical to Sno3p; expression is induced before the diauxic shift and also in the absence of thiamin
Synonyms YNL334C
